In digital conversations across the U.S., a quiet shift is unfolding—one that challenges the stereotype of the “small” or passive personality. Users are increasingly talking about how someone once seen as mild, reserved, or unassuming can quietly evolve into a force marked by sharp emotional detachment and steeled resolve—what some describe as the “Misty Meaner” persona. No flashes of anger, no overt aggression—just a deepening intensity hidden beneath calm surfaces. What drives this transformation? Why does it matter now? And how does this hidden depth shape real-world behavior in work, relationships, and digital spaces?

Contrary to common perception, this persona isn’t about sudden outbursts. Instead, it’s a calibrated evolution: someone gradually raises emotional boundaries or asserts control after prolonged observation or subtle resistance. Behavior often includes measured responses, strategic silence, and a confidence grounded in non-verbal intensity. In professional settings, this can mean decisive leadership without aggression; in personal dynamics, a boundary-setting calm that commands respect without provocation.

Across social media, self-help forums, and professional networks, a pattern is emerging. Many people report encountering individuals who appeared relatively passive or composed before suddenly adopting a tone and demeanor that commands attention—calm, deliberate, and unyielding under pressure. This quiet shift challenges the assumption that strength flows only from outspokenness or visible confrontation.

This phenomenon isn’t new, but recent cultural, economic, and psychological trends are amplifying visibility of this dynamic. In an era of heightened emotional awareness, experts note that quiet persistence and strategic emotional distance—once mistaken for passivity—are being recognized as powerful tools for influence and resilience. The “Misty Meaner” evolves not from sudden rage, but from accumulated experience, careful observation, and a growing awareness of power dynamics.
